US State Department Supports Anti-Semitism Curbs By EU

Gary Fitleberg, January 4, 2005

The U.S. State Department praised the work of European governments against anti-Semitism, but said law enforcement must do more to respond to anti-Semitic crimes.

The State Department's report addressing anti-Semitic incidents around the world comes after Congress passed a law last year mandating increased monitoring of anti-Semitism in Europe and elsewhere.
